Transaction e0563aeaaede839c869dbaacdb05fdb353321dd0f274a2875104800571236071

1 Input
2 Outputs
  • e0563aeaaede839c869dbaacdb05fdb353321dd0f274a2875104800571236071:0
  • value  18842372
    address  3B5iZA3sxNaGA6QqpT6EZNsmPCniFw4SEE
  • e0563aeaaede839c869dbaacdb05fdb353321dd0f274a2875104800571236071:1
  • value  481154126
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v